Which is a redox reaction?

A) 2KBr + F2 ---> 2KF + Br2
B) 2HCL + Mg(OH)2 --> 2HOH + MgCl2
C) 2NaCl + H2SO4 --> Na2SO4 + 2HCl
D) Ca(OH)2 + Pb(NO3)2 --> Ca(NO3)2 + Pb(OH)2

I know the answer is A, but confused as to why that is. Can someone explain this for me? Thanks.

You have to look at the oxidation states of each atom in the reaction. Since redox reactions involve the transfer of electrons from one element to another, 2 elements need to have oxidation state changes.
option a is the only option that has a change in oxidation sates. Fluorine goes from 0 to -1 indicating that it gained electrons (got reduced) while bromine goes from -1 to 0 indicating it loses electrons (got oxidized).
(2Br⁻→Br₂+2e⁻ and F₂+2e⁻→2F⁻).
